Important Considerations Before You Customize
Before you start customizing your Lonestar, there are a few important considerations to keep in mind.
-
Budget: Customization can be expensive, so it's important to set a budget and stick to it. Prioritize the upgrades that are most important to you and shop around for the best prices.
-
Regulations: Be aware of any regulations that may restrict certain types of modifications. For example, some states have restrictions on lighting and exhaust modifications.
-
Warranty: Some modifications may void your truck's warranty, so it's important to check with your dealer before making any changes.
-
Professional Installation: For complex modifications, it's best to have them installed by a qualified technician. This will ensure that the modifications are done correctly and safely.
-
Resale Value: While customization can enhance the value of your Lonestar, it's important to choose modifications that will appeal to a wide range of buyers. Overly personalized modifications may reduce the resale value of your truck.
Common Mistakes to Avoid Are:
-
Neglecting Functionality for Aesthetics: Don't sacrifice comfort, safety, or performance for purely aesthetic upgrades.
-
Ignoring Regulations: Make sure all modifications comply with local and federal regulations.
-
Skipping Professional Installation: Attempting complex modifications yourself can lead to costly mistakes and safety hazards.
-
Overspending on Unnecessary Upgrades: Focus on the upgrades that will provide the most value and avoid unnecessary expenses.
-
Forgetting About Maintenance: Customized trucks still require regular maintenance. Don't neglect routine maintenance tasks.
